Output d3c8d27d9f03109062de034b01d4ea7546b86220f746fa7e7b437fa362d05b53:1

value
389717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2330350fd9238413f3127a952324186baaf5479 OP_EQUAL
address
3NK3kLeqVS3m93RWPmCGzWrRhgyVsVbuwS
transaction
d3c8d27d9f03109062de034b01d4ea7546b86220f746fa7e7b437fa362d05b53
confirmations
158945
spent
true